Why Build a Porch?
A porch enhances the outside of a home, including character and value. Here are some advantages of having a porch:
- Increased Curb Appeal: A properly designed porch can enhance the overall appearance of your home.
- Outdoor Living Space: Provides an extra area to captivate visitors or take pleasure in household time outdoors.
- Security from Weather: Offers shelter from the rain and sun, enabling year-round use.
- Increased Property Value: A porch can be a selling point for prospective buyers.

Preparation Your Porch Construction
Steps to Plan Your Porch
Identify the Purpose:
- Decide how you wish to use your porch. Will it be a place to unwind, amuse, or as a port for plants?
Set a Budget:
- Estimate the overall cost, consisting of materials, labor, and permits. It's important to have a clear spending plan to prevent overspending.
Choose a Style:
- Consider architectural designs that match your home. Research numerous styles and materials.
Inspect Local Regulations:
- Verify local building regulations and zoning guidelines. Some areas require licenses for porch construction.
Produce a Design:
- Sketch your ideas or seek advice from with a designer or designer to finalize your porch's design and structure.
Key Materials to Consider
The materials you pick can greatly affect the sturdiness and aesthetics of your porch. Here's a table to help you select:
| Material Type |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Wood | Natural appearance, easy to work with. | Can rot, requires maintenance. |
| Composite | Low maintenance, readily available in various colors. | Can be more expensive than wood. |
| PVC | Durable, waterproof, easy to clean. | Limited color options. |
| Concrete | Extremely durable, low maintenance. | Harder to tailor visually. |
| Brick or Stone | Timeless appeal, resilient. | Greater installation costs. |
FAQ
1. Do I require an authorization to build a porch?
Yes, in a lot of locations, you will require a permit. Contact your regional building department for requirements specific to your area.
2. How long does it take to construct a porch?
The time frame can vary based upon the size and intricacy of the style. A basic porch may take a few days, while larger structures could take weeks.
3. What is the average cost of developing a porch?
The expense can vary extensively based upon size, products, and place. On average, house owners may invest in between 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 15,000 for a brand-new porch.
4. Can I develop my porch without professional help?
While it's possible to construct a porch yourself, it may require customized skills, especially for structural stability and compliance with guidelines. Hiring professionals can guarantee a higher quality finish.
